Common charges include unlawful possession, carrying a concealed weapon without a permit, and possession of prohibited firearms or weapons.
Each charge has specific criteria and penalties, making professional legal advice essential to navigate the complexities.
Yes, even lawful possession must comply with Missouri laws, including permits and restrictions in certain locations.
Violations can result in criminal charges, so understanding your rights and responsibilities is critical.
Weapons charges can lead to criminal records affecting employment, housing, and civil rights such as firearm ownership.
Prompt and skilled legal defense can mitigate these impacts and help protect your future opportunities.
